American Water: A Legacy of Community Commitment and Support

As American Water Works Company, Inc. approaches its 140th anniversary in 2026, it leans heavily into its longstanding tradition of providing essential water and wastewater services across the United States. The company, which has grown to serve over 14 million customers in 14 states, marks this momentous occasion with a renewed focus on infrastructure investment aimed at increasing service reliability and affordability. CEO John Griffith underscores this initiative with plans to allocate up to $48 billion over the next decade for critical infrastructure upgrades, pointing to the firm’s commitment to not only maintain, but also enhance service delivery as a core priority.

Beyond the financial commitments to infrastructure, American Water is also celebrating significant milestones in community engagement and philanthropy. The upcoming anniversary coincides with the 15th anniversary of the American Water Charitable Foundation, which has contributed more than $25 million to various charitable causes since its inception. With programs that have a direct community impact, the Foundation's “Keep Communities Flowing” initiative embodies the company’s mission by addressing crucial social issues while ensuring that water remains accessible and affordable. American Water's commitment to its communities aligns with its overarching philosophy of enhancing the well-being of the markets it serves and reflects a broader responsibility to societal welfare.

Moreover, the company’s strong emphasis on employee involvement amplifies its outreach efforts. Staff across various subsidiaries, including Virginia and Maryland American Water, have actively participated in volunteer work and fundraising efforts that amount to hundreds of thousands of dollars in charitable contributions. This ground-up approach not only helps foster a sense of community involvement among employees but also establishes a culture of giving, strengthening bonds within the communities American Water serves. As the company prepares to commemorate its anniversary, various events such as ringing The Closing Bell at the New York Stock Exchange signal a recognition of its legacy and ongoing commitment to its mission of providing safe, clean, and reliable water service for generations to come.

In related initiatives, American Water’s subsidiaries have made strides in philanthropy and community support. For instance, Virginia American Water recently announced charitable contributions totaling over $357,000, while Maryland American Water followed suit with $196,000 distributed to local organizations. These efforts highlight not only a dedication to service but also a proactive approach to engaging with and uplifting local communities through targeted assistance programs.

Overall, American Water’s upcoming 140th anniversary and its strategic investments into infrastructure and community initiatives serve as a testament to its enduring legacy and commitment to sustaining safe and affordable water services.
